** The GMC repair market serving Moffat, Colorado, is characterized by its reliance on regional specialists rather than local in-town options. Moffat itself, with a population of around 100, does not support a dedicated GMC specialist. Residents typically travel to Alamosa (approx. 30 miles) or Salida (approx. 40 miles) for expert service. **Average Quality:** The quality of service available is surprisingly high, driven by the demands of the local economy which is heavily dependent on agriculture, ranching, and tourism. This creates a need for shops that can expertly service heavy-duty trucks, complex diesel engines, and 4WD systems. The top providers are not just general mechanics; they are specialists who have invested in specific training and equipment. **Competition Level:** Competition is moderate among the top-tier shops, but they often have specialized niches (e.g., High Country for performance diesel, Salida Ford Chrysler for authorized transmission work). This prevents direct price wars and encourages a focus on service quality and technical reputation. There are several general repair shops, but they lack the specific expertise for the complex systems on modern GMCs.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is competitive with national averages but can be slightly higher than in urban areas due to the specialized nature of the work and the cost of transporting parts. Expect to pay dealership-level labor rates for the most specialized work (e.g., transmission rebuilds, Duramax injector replacement) but with often more personalized service. A standard service like an Allison transmission fluid change will be in the $250-$350 range, while major diagnostics or engine work can quickly run into the thousands.

Given the high-altitude, rural driving conditions around Moffat and the San Luis Valley, common issues include suspension and steering component wear from rough roads, along with cooling system and thermostat problems exacerbated by temperature extremes. Diesel-powered GMC trucks like the Sierra 2500/3500 may also require more frequent attention to emissions systems and fuel filters.
Due to Moffat's small size, you may need to look at shops in nearby Alamosa or the wider San Luis Valley; seek shops with certified GM or ASE technicians and strong reviews from local ranchers and outdoor enthusiasts. A quality shop will have experience with the 4WD systems common on local GMCs and use quality diagnostic tools for modern GM electronics.
Labor rates in the Moffat area can be competitive, but parts availability may cause delays, potentially increasing downtime costs for specialized components. Building a relationship with a local shop that can anticipate needs for common models like the Sierra or Yukon can help manage overall repair expenses.
Seek immediate service for any 4WD system failure, overheating warnings, or brake issues, as these are critical for safe travel on remote county roads and mountain passes around Saguache County. Also, address any "Check Engine" light promptly, as altitude can worsen underlying engine or emissions problems.
Prioritize more frequent inspections of tires, batteries, and antifreeze/coolant due to the region's extreme temperature swings and long distances between services. If you use your truck for hauling, farming, or accessing high-country properties, inform your technician so they can tailor service to these strenuous local uses.
